Hi, Cody. Did you try French Contrast Method in your gym routine? What is your experience? It's look like circle training of couple of sets (set of 4 exercises) with 1) Heavy exercise (80%+ intensity, 20-30 sec rest > 2) Plyometric exercise with body mass (3-5 reps) >20-30 sec rest > 3) Weighted plyo/jump exercise (about 30-50% load, 3-5 reps) > 20-30 sec rest > 4) Assisted (accelerated) plyo (with help of bands) 4-6 reps > 4-5mins rest > new set. I also saw variations with some bigger recovery times (1-2 min) between exercises. It's variation of complex trainings (contrast, ascending, descending, french contrast). What did you try, how long (how much mesocycles) and what response and results were? Thank you.

I prefer squat cleans to progress to a full clean and jerk. Is that going to compromise my max sprint time for the 100m? I keep getting this nagging voice in my head saying I will lose stiffness, and all I ever see are sprinters doing power variations.
@ATHLETE.X
@ATHLETE.X 10 ай бұрын
I don’t know that it will detract from your stiffness greatly unless you do massive volume of full cleans. I’ve known of coaches who teach full cleans first and then progress to power clean later on and they get good results. I would suggest progressing like this: full clean -> power clean -> hang clean -> drop hang clean (quick eccentric lowering then pull)
